The Norway Tendonitis Treatment Market is witnessing growth owing to the rising prevalence of tendon-related injuries, particularly among individuals engaged in physical activities and sports. The market is characterized by a variety of treatment options including physical therapy, medication, corticosteroid injections, shockwave therapy, and in severe cases, surgery. Additionally, the market is seeing a surge in the adoption of alternative treatments such as acupuncture and herbal remedies. Key players in the market are focusing on developing innovative treatment methods and products to cater to the increasing demand for effective tendonitis management. Factors such as the aging population, growing awareness about tendonitis, and advancements in healthcare infrastructure are expected to drive the market further in the coming years.

In the Norway Tendonitis Treatment Market, some key challenges include limited awareness among the general population about tendonitis, leading to underdiagnosis and undertreatment of the condition. Additionally, there may be a lack of standardization in treatment approaches, with varying practices among healthcare professionals, which can result in inconsistent care for patients. Access to specialized healthcare providers or facilities that focus on tendonitis treatment may also be limited in certain regions, potentially causing delays in diagnosis and management. Furthermore, the high cost of certain treatment options or therapies for tendonitis could pose a barrier to patients seeking effective care. Overall, addressing these challenges would require efforts to increase public education, promote standardized treatment guidelines, improve access to specialized care, and explore more cost-effective treatment solutions in the Norway Tendonitis Treatment Market.

The Norwegian government emphasizes preventive measures to address tendonitis within the healthcare system. Policies prioritize education on ergonomics and proper workplace practices to reduce the risk of developing tendonitis. Additionally, the government promotes early detection and intervention through regular health check-ups and screenings, aiming to prevent the progression of tendonitis to more severe stages. Treatment options are often covered by the national healthcare system, ensuring accessibility and affordability for all residents. Moreover, the government encourages research and innovation in tendonitis treatment, fostering collaboration between healthcare providers and researchers to enhance treatment outcomes and patient care in the Norway Tendonitis Treatment Market.
